New gameplay videos for Sir, You Are Being Hunted
RPS has posted two gameplay videos of Big Robot’s Sir, You Are Being Hunted. The videos depict running, gunning and scavenging across the game’s procedurally generated islands. Check them out below.
Big Robot is three-person indie dev team headed-up by veteran RPS writer, Jim Rossignol. The crowd-funded title is available for pre-order via the Humble store. The game will also be playable at Eurogamer and RPS’ PC-centric show, Rezzed, which is taking place in Birmingham in June.

Ragnarok Online 2 beta now under way
Gravity Interactive has announced that fantasy MMORPG sequel Ragnarok Online 2: Legend of the Second has entered open beta testing. Ragnarok 2 tells the story of Freyja, a once beautiful and merciful goddess who got a bit ragey after her husband Odin’s betrayal set her on a path of destruction and revenge. Uh-oh.

Namco Bandai site teases “btw”
A Namco Bandai teaser site has appeared carrying a black and white image of a motorbike and a handful of wistful words. The site URL bears the letters “btw”, while the site text reads: “The old days are sketched in his eyes, memories that have passed come and go in his heart.” Mysterious.
